Output e9f03c35801ee7189dbacef47e0eeae242b19700755a4c7fba47f130db1775a9:8

value
509805397
script pubkey
OP_0 OP_PUSHBYTES_20 deeb3eadb39f3a2f4bb93556bed2692fecb3b0af
address
bc1qmm4natdnnuaz7jaex4tta5nf9lkt8v90fwfn6t
transaction
e9f03c35801ee7189dbacef47e0eeae242b19700755a4c7fba47f130db1775a9
confirmations
109912
spent
true